**Ticket: Bloom filter misconfig on prod-east**

The Hollowbine bloom filter fronting the Verrick KV store is passing everything through — false-positive rate config never loaded, so every lookup hits the store directly. Latency up 4x. Cause: env file on prod-east lacks the filter service credential, so the sidecar falls back to passthrough mode. Fix is config-only, no restart of the KV nodes needed. Append the following line to the node's .env.

vault entry, kahop-fafof: VAULT_KEY13=b5d28d67751c4

Welcome aboard. LedgerLoom produces payroll exports for Quillbrook's downstream finance systems. We recently switched the export format from fixed-width to delimited records, and each environment migrated on its own schedule — dev first, then staging, then production during the Harwick quarter close. Feature flags control which format an environment emits, so never assume both formats behave identically. Staging is the only place you should test format changes. For reference, staging currently runs with the following configuration.

service settings:
PRAIX_LOG_LEVEL=error
PRAIX_METRICS_HOST=metrics.praix.qorvelcorp.corp
PRAIX_POOL_SIZE=16

Subject: Quickstore 4.2 — bloom filter now fronts the KV layer

Plugin authors: starting with this release, Quickstore places a bloom filter ahead of the key-value store. Negative lookups return faster; false positives fall through safely. No API changes are required on your side. Verify your plugin against the staging build referenced below.

session token of fahif-tadup = htk3_9c7